The Type I Collagen-coatedCulture Dish Market was valued at USD 44.23 million in 2025 and is projected to grow to USD 50.22 million in 2026, with a CAGR of 13.90%, reaching USD 110.01 million by 2032.

KEY MARKET STATISTICS
Base Year [2025] USD 44.23 million
Estimated Year [2026] USD 50.22 million
Forecast Year [2032] USD 110.01 million
CAGR (%) 13.90%

Contextual introduction to Type I collagen-coated culture dishes highlighting scientific function, end-user expectations, and technical sourcing considerations for decision-makers

Type I collagen-coated culture dishes serve as foundational substrates across a range of life-science workflows, providing a biologically relevant interface that supports cell adhesion, proliferation, and phenotype preservation. As laboratory workflows increasingly pivot toward complex cell models and translational applications, the role of surface coatings in ensuring experimental reproducibility and physiological relevance has become more pronounced. Researchers and product developers depend on consistent surface chemistry, controlled coating thickness, and traceable material sourcing to enable reliable outcomes from basic cell culture to advanced tissue models.

Contemporary interest in these coated surfaces spans both discovery-phase research and preclinical workstreams, where matrix composition and surface treatment method influence cellular behavior, assay sensitivity, and downstream translational potential. In turn, end users such as academic research institutes, contract research organizations, hospitals, and pharmaceutical and biotech firms demand a broader range of product formats, from multiwell plates compatible with automation to custom culture plates and T-flasks for bespoke applications. This diversification in use cases, paired with evolving regulatory scrutiny around biologics-derived inputs and contamination risks, creates a complex decision environment for procurement leaders and technical teams.

Consequently, manufacturers and distributors are navigating a technical landscape defined by material provenance choices, surface treatment innovations, and supply chain resilience. Translational imperatives-moving from adherent cell culture and stem cell workflows to organotypic and scaffold-engineered systems-amplify requirements for reproducible coatings that support both high-throughput screening and long-term culture. The following sections synthesize the major shifts, trade-offs, and practical implications influencing stakeholders across the ecosystem.

Transformative technological, regulatory, and distributional shifts that are redefining product expectations and supplier differentiation across the collagen-coated culture dish ecosystem

The landscape for Type I collagen-coated culture dishes is being reshaped by converging technological, regulatory, and application-driven forces that are accelerating product evolution and supplier differentiation. Advances in recombinant protein production and surface chemistry have lowered barriers to entry for alternative material sources, prompting a gradual shift from traditional animal-derived collagen toward recombinant variants that offer greater lot-to-lot consistency and lower contamination risk. At the same time, improvements in surface treatment methods-such as covalent binding strategies and controlled layer-by-layer assembly-enable more precise control of ligand density and coating durability, which are critical for complex cell systems and prolonged culture studies.

Concurrently, the proliferation of organotypic models and scaffold engineering has increased demand for specialized formats and coating thickness profiles that support three-dimensional cell organization and mechanical integrative properties. This trend intersects with automation and assay development requirements, where multiwell plates and standardized formats must remain compatible with high-throughput screening workflows while supporting adherent or stem cell cultures. Distribution channels are also evolving: digital procurement platforms and direct-sale arrangements are increasingly used alongside traditional distributor networks and OEM partnerships to accommodate rapid, customizable orders and support integrated instrument-reagent solutions.

Regulatory and ethical considerations are further influencing strategic choices. Institutions and commercial labs are reassessing procurement policies to minimize the risks associated with animal-derived biologicals, favoring suppliers that can demonstrate traceability and validated production controls. Such pressures are catalyzing product innovations and contractual arrangements that emphasize transparency in material sourcing, robust quality systems, and collaborative development pathways between suppliers and end users. Together, these shifts are creating a more nuanced value proposition for collagen-coated substrates that balances technical performance, supply certainty, and regulatory alignment.

Analysis of the operational and strategic consequences of United States tariff adjustments in 2025 that are prompting supply chain realignment and sourcing diversification across the sector

United States tariff changes implemented in 2025 have introduced a series of operational and strategic ramifications for manufacturers, distributors, and end users operating within global value chains. Elevated import duties on certain raw materials and finished laboratory goods have sharpened cost pressures and compelled supply chain re-evaluations across the sector. Sourcing decisions are now being influenced by tariff differentials, prompting purchasers to weigh nearshore options, alternative material suppliers, and vertically integrated production strategies that reduce cross-border exposure to duty volatility.

The tariff environment has also accelerated interest in recombinant material sources and domestic manufacturing partnerships. Because recombinant collagen can often be produced closer to demand centers, organizations are assessing whether shifting away from animal-derived inputs mitigates customs complexity and supports more predictable lead times. For suppliers reliant on bovine or porcine sources that are commonly concentrated in specific geographies, tariffs have exposed the vulnerability of single-source strategies and underscored the value of diversified supply bases and contingency stocking approaches.

Distribution channels feel a secondary impact as well. Distributors and OEMs are reconfiguring commercial terms to absorb some tariff-related margin pressure while preserving service levels. Direct sales models and online procurement platforms have become more attractive for clients seeking transparency on landed costs and expedited fulfillment. Contract research organizations and pharmaceutical companies are engaging in collaborative sourcing agreements and multi-year contracts to stabilize pricing and guarantee supply continuity. Ultimately, the tariff changes of 2025 are functioning as a catalyst for structural adjustments: companies that proactively adapt their sourcing, production footprint, and channel strategies are positioned to preserve operational resilience and maintain competitive differentiation in a tariff-influenced trade environment.

Comprehensive segmentation-driven insights articulating how application, end-user, product type, distribution, material source, surface treatment, and coating thickness determine supplier strategies

A layered understanding of market segmentation reveals how application needs, end-user profiles, product formats, distribution pathways, material sources, surface treatments, and coating thickness converge to define buyer requirements and supplier positioning. Across application categories, cell culture users demand surfaces optimized for both adherent cell culture and stem cell culture, whereas drug screening customers prioritize assay development and high-throughput screening compatibility; regenerative medicine stakeholders focus on bone regeneration and wound healing use cases, and tissue engineering teams require solutions suitable for organotypic models and scaffold engineering. These divergent application imperatives drive distinct performance specifications for adhesion ligand presentation, mechanical stability, and sterilization compatibility.

End users exhibit differentiated procurement behaviors that influence product evolution. Academic research institutes, composed of government research centers and university laboratories, often prioritize reproducibility, affordability, and technical documentation for publication-grade work. Contract research organizations require scalable formats, traceable supply chains, and robust quality agreements. Hospitals and clinics emphasize clinical compliance, lot traceability, and biocompatibility for translational workflows. Pharmaceutical and biotech companies, spanning large pharma to small and mid-size biotech, seek certified supply partners, flexible packaging and formats, and integration with automated screening platforms to accelerate development timelines.

Product type considerations play a central role in application fit and operational convenience. Multiwell plates must reconcile compatibility with automation and imaging platforms, standard culture plates serve general-purpose laboratory needs, and T-flasks are preferred for scale-up and preliminary expansion workflows. Distribution channels shape availability and total cost of ownership. Direct sales relationships support customized specifications and technical support; distributors expand geographic reach and bundled procurement options; online sales accelerate reordering cycles and transparency on lead times; and OEM partnerships embed coating technology into instrument ecosystems to deliver integrated workflows.

Material source and surface treatment method are core determinants of performance and regulatory acceptance. Animal derived collagen, sourced from bovine or porcine origins, remains prevalent where traditional biological context is prioritized, but recombinant production-whether E. coli derived or yeast derived-offers improved consistency and lower contamination risk. Surface treatment choices span adsorption, covalent binding, layer-by-layer assembly, and plasma treatment, with each technique presenting trade-offs in durability, ligand orientation, and manufacturing scalability. Finally, coating thickness profiles classified as high, medium, or low thickness affect cellular interactions, nutrient diffusion, and mechanical response, necessitating clear alignment between coating specifications and the intended cellular system. Synthesizing these segmentation dimensions provides a structured framework for product development, quality systems, and commercial positioning that aligns technical capability with user expectations.

Key regional dynamics that differentiate procurement priorities, regulatory considerations, and supplier competitiveness across the Americas, EMEA, and Asia-Pacific geographies

Regional dynamics exhibit distinctive demand drivers, regulatory contexts, and supply chain considerations that influence strategic priorities for manufacturers and purchasers. In the Americas, procurement is influenced by a mix of academic research intensity and a robust pharmaceutical and biotech sector that prioritizes quality assurance, domestic sourcing options, and integrated vendor support. Regulatory oversight and institutional policies favor suppliers who can demonstrate traceability and validated production processes, while buyers place a premium on rapid fulfillment and technical service to support translational pipelines.

Across Europe, Middle East & Africa, diverse regulatory regimes and research funding environments produce a heterogeneous demand landscape. European markets often emphasize compliance with stringent biologics and chemical safety regulations, encouraging the adoption of recombinant materials and advanced surface treatments. Middle Eastern and African markets display variable adoption rates, with pockets of high demand linked to regional research hubs and clinical translation activities. In this region, distributors and local partners play a pivotal role in navigating regulatory approval pathways and adapting commercial models to local procurement practices.

The Asia-Pacific region is marked by rapid capacity expansion in both reagent manufacturing and research infrastructure. Countries across this geography are investing in domestic production capabilities and upstream bioprocessing technologies, which can reduce reliance on imports and mitigate tariff exposure. Regional demand is driven by a combination of academic excellence, contract research services, and a growing industrial biotech sector that seeks scalable, cost-efficient solutions. As a result, suppliers that tailor product formats to regional automation standards and ensure multilingual technical support gain competitive advantage.

Corporate competitive positioning and partner ecosystems that combine surface chemistry expertise, manufacturing resilience, and distribution capabilities to serve diverse research and translational needs

Competitive dynamics in the sector are defined by a spectrum of specialist reagent manufacturers, integrated instrument OEMs, contract manufacturers, and distribution-focused organizations, each bringing distinct capabilities to the value chain. Specialist reagent companies differentiate through validated material sources, proprietary surface treatment know-how, and quality management systems that support regulated environments. Integrated OEMs offer product bundles that combine coated substrates with instruments and consumables, simplifying workflows for high-throughput and imaging applications. Contract manufacturers and private-label producers enable scale and customization, supporting both niche academic requirements and large-scale commercial demand.

Partnerships and strategic alliances are increasingly common as companies seek to pair surface chemistry expertise with scalable production and global distribution networks. Licensing and co-development agreements accelerate the translation of novel coating technologies into standardized product formats, while joint validation programs between suppliers and end users build confidence in new material sources and treatment methods. Distribution partners remain critical for market access, particularly in regions where regulatory complexity or localized purchasing practices necessitate close collaboration and on-the-ground support.

Investments in manufacturing resilience, traceability systems, and quality certifications are key differentiators. Companies that can demonstrate consistent lot performance, transparent sourcing documentation, and robust supply continuity plans are better positioned to capture demand from risk-averse institutional buyers and regulated clients. As technical requirements evolve, competitive advantage will accrue to organizations that combine deep domain expertise in collagen biology and surface engineering with flexible production capabilities and global logistical reach.
